JerameeUC commited on
Commit ·
269b3f6
1
Parent(s): d3c9e13
Fixed what I broke maybe maybe
Browse files- core/storefront.py +4 -1
core/storefront.py
CHANGED
|
@@ -59,9 +59,12 @@ def storefront_qna(data, user_text: str):
|
|
| 59 |
if t in {"parking"}:
|
| 60 |
_, pr = get_rules(data)
|
| 61 |
if pr: return "Parking rules:\n- " + "\n- ".join(pr)
|
| 62 |
-
|
|
|
|
|
|
|
| 63 |
vr, _ = get_rules(data)
|
| 64 |
if vr: return "Venue rules:\n- " + "\n- ".join(vr)
|
|
|
|
| 65 |
if t in {"passes", "parking pass", "parking passes"}:
|
| 66 |
return "Yes, multiple parking passes are allowed per student."
|
| 67 |
|
|
|
|
| 59 |
if t in {"parking"}:
|
| 60 |
_, pr = get_rules(data)
|
| 61 |
if pr: return "Parking rules:\n- " + "\n- ".join(pr)
|
| 62 |
+
|
| 63 |
+
# NEW: map 'wear' directly to venue rules to avoid LLM hallucinations
|
| 64 |
+
if t in {"venue", "attire", "dress", "dress code", "wear"} or "what should i wear" in t:
|
| 65 |
vr, _ = get_rules(data)
|
| 66 |
if vr: return "Venue rules:\n- " + "\n- ".join(vr)
|
| 67 |
+
|
| 68 |
if t in {"passes", "parking pass", "parking passes"}:
|
| 69 |
return "Yes, multiple parking passes are allowed per student."
|
| 70 |
|